Just like every year, Comme des Garçons has launched its Happy Holidays capsule to celebrate the holidays and the New Year. This time round, the brand's founder Rei Kawakubo has tapped nine of the most sought-after designers on the fashion scene at the moment: Alessandro Michele for Gucci, Riccardo Tisci for Burberry, Maison Margiela, Jean Paul Gaultier, Walter Van Beirendonck, Simone Rocha, Craig Green, Marine Serre and Stüssy.

Each one has come up with an iconic product reinterpreted through the prism of the Japanese brand. Although most of the designers have opted for a t-shirt, including Jean Paul Gaultier, who has revisited his breton striped top with red dots, the capsule also offers a tartan Burberry scarf and a Gucci shopper bag in plastic-coated brown paper featuring the brand's famous green and red stripes. 

For the creative partnership,  Maison Margiela has contributed a new version of the white t-shirt that the OTB-owned label has released every year since Autumn/Winter 1994 to support the fight against AIDS.

The collection was launched in Japan on 23 November at Comme des Garçons and Dover Street Market Ginza, with the international release currently slated for 5 December.
